Overview
XCKU085-3FLVA1517E from AMD is a high-performance Kintex UltraScale FPGA featuring 1,053K logic cells, 64.8 Mb of block RAM, and support for up to 32.75 GT/s via 32 GTH transceivers. It integrates hardened PCIe Gen3 x16, 100G Ethernet MAC, and DDR4 memory controllers, targeting high-bandwidth data processing in radar signal conditioning and 5G baseband subsystems.
For engineers reviewing the XCKU085-3FLVA1517E datasheet, pinout, applications, or equivalent options, key selection criteria include transceiver line rate, I/O voltage flexibility (1.2 V to 1.8 V), thermal design power (29.5 W typical), and FLVA1517 package compatibility with high-speed PCB routing constraints.
Technical Context
The XCKU085-3FLVA1517E implements a heterogeneous architecture with programmable logic fabric, UltraScale+ DSP slices (2,520 units), and integrated hard IP including dual 100G Ethernet MACs and quad 10G/25G Ethernet PCS/PMA. Its transceivers support PAM4 and NRZ modulation with built-in PRBS generators and error detectors.
It delivers deterministic low-latency routing via dedicated clock networks and supports partial reconfiguration for dynamic function swapping in mission-critical avionics and test equipment applications without full device reboot.

FAQ
What is the maximum supported data rate for the GTH transceivers on the XCKU085-3FLVA1517E?
The XCKU085-3FLVA1517E supports GTH transceivers rated up to 32.75 GT/s, enabling protocols such as 100G Ethernet (4×25G), CPRI Option 10, and JESD204B subclass 1. This rate is achievable under specified voltage, temperature, and board layout conditions per UG578 v1.14.
Does the XCKU085-3FLVA1517E support partial reconfiguration?
Yes, the XCKU085-3FLVA1517E fully supports partial reconfiguration as defined in UG909. It allows dynamic swapping of logical modules while maintaining active functionality in other regions-critical for fault-tolerant avionics and adaptive radio systems where continuous operation is mandatory.
What I/O standards are supported by the HP I/O banks on the XCKU085-3FLVA1517E?
The HP I/O banks on the XCKU085-3FLVA1517E support LVCMOS, SSTL, HSTL, and differential standards including LVDS and BLVDS at voltages from 1.2 V to 1.8 V. Each bank is independently configurable, allowing mixed-voltage interfaces on a single device.
Is the XCKU085-3FLVA1517E qualified for automotive applications?
No, the XCKU085-3FLVA1517E is not AEC-Q100 qualified. It is rated for commercial and industrial temperature ranges only (0°C to +100°C). For automotive use, AMD offers the XCKU085-3FLVA1517I variant with extended temperature screening and qualification documentation.
What configuration modes does the XCKU085-3FLVA1517E support?
The XCKU085-3FLVA1517E supports Master SPI, Slave SelectMAP, and JTAG configuration modes. It also enables fallback configuration from dual BPI flash devices and supports secure bitstream encryption using AES-256 keys stored in eFUSE.
